Introduction

Hard West is the first great slam down of a Western Turn-Based Strategy title in basically forever. What's more it's not just about the harsh wastelands of the Frontier, but also features smatterings of the occult, and some crazy science in some instances. It's a title that follows two main storylines, each broken down into four or five scenarios. In each scenario you'll play a progression of that story, but perhaps in the viewpoint of a different, sometimes an entirely new character. It swings some rather interesting possibilities just within reach, all for a rather tantalising price too. For the first time you could say that Hard West has genuinely brought in some fresh looking mechanics for you to play about with too. Is it all too good to be true?
